Born 1948 - Northern Ireland politician.


Politically active from a young age, he joined the Irish Nationalist Party, Sinn Fein, the political wing of the IRA. In 1978 he was elected vice-president of Sinn Fein and later became president. In 1982 he was elected to the Northern Island Assembly and in 1983 to the UK Parliament. His publications include autobiographies Falls Memories (1982), Cage Eleven (1990) and Before the Dawn (1996). Other works are Politics of Irish Freedom (1986), Pathway to Peace (1988) and An Irish Voice: The Quest for Peace (1997).
